Modern NSAC Spiritualism was formally established after an encounter by the Fox sisters with the spirit of a peddlar, Charles B. Rosna on March 31, 1848.
The Augusta Spiritualist Church has been serving its community since 1909, when it started as a home circle. They started holding services and classes in 1925 at its former site on the corner of Perham and Court streets. Recently, a new building was constructed at 113 Townsend Rd.
The Augusta Spiritualist Church, is a hierarchical auxiliary of the Maine State Spiritualist Association of Churches (MSSAC). MSSAC in turn is a hierarchical auxilliary of the National Spiritualist Association of Churches (NSAC) of Lily Dale, New York.

Our Mission
Our mission is to educate individuals and propagate the beauty of the realm of Spirit. As Spiritualists we know that life continues after the transition to death of the physical. This continuity is demonstrated through the practice of mediumship.
Spiritualism is a religion, science as well as a philosophy.

One of the central tenets of Spiritualism is the belief in communication with the spirit world. The church provides opportunities for individuals to receive messages from deceased loved ones, spirit guides, or other entities through mediumship. This can offer comfort, closure, or guidance to those who have lost someone or who seek insight from the unseen realms.
